Post by caricatureartist on May 8, 2011 7:58:00 GMT -5
I've been waiting quite a while to try this festival. They say about 100,000 attendance over 5 days, but the promoters are up to charging $600-$650 per 10x10 now, which is way too much for me. Every year it goes up about $25-$50. Since I don't take up much space, a friend of mine "rented" me a small spot next to his trailer (he does sign carving out of it). There were 3 other cartoonists drawing, and with me made 4. I tried Wed. night and Thurs. night to see how things would go, but it was too slow and not enough business to go around, so I blew town Fri. morning. Started to get really hot in Vegas around this time. Mostly carnival rides and booths with games at this festival. Also tons of various food booths. Not many arts & crafts. I thought there would be more. Vendors say this festival has suffered since it moved from downtown (somewhere on Flamingo was it?) to the parking lot at Silverton Casino. Apparently, someone bought the property on Flamingo and the festival had to move a few years ago. I lucked out as I was able to get a spot at Eckerstrom's Mother's Day show in Alameda this weekend. I drove back all day Friday, and went to Alameda on Sat. & Sun. Will post on that show later.
